Label free electrochemiluminescence protocol for sensitive dna detection with a tris(2,2'-bipyridyl)ruthenium(ii) modified electrode based on nucleic acid oxidation

英文摘要Label free electrochemiluminescence (ecl) dna detection based on catalytic guanine and adenine bases oxidation using tris(2,2'-bipyridyl)ruthenium(ii) [ru(bpy)(3)(2+)] modified glassy carbon (gc) electrode was demonstrated in this work. the modified gc electrode was prepared by casting carbon nanotubes (cnt)/nafion/ru(bpy)(3)(2+) composite film on the electrode surface. ecl signals of doublestranded dna and their thermally denatured counterparts can be distinctly discriminated using cyclic voltammetry (cv) with a low concentration (3.04 x 10(-8) mol/l for salmon testes-dna). most importantly, sensitive single-base mismatch detection of p53 gene sequence segment was realized with 3.93 x 10(-10) mol/l employing cv stimulation (ecl signal of c/a mismatched dna oligonucleotides was 1.5-fold higher than that of fully base-paired dna oligonucleotides). label free, high sensitivity and simplicity for single-base mismatch discrimination were the main advantages of the present ecl technique for dna detection over the traditional dna sensors.
